The Minisforum M1 Plus mini PC has hit the market at an exceptionally low price. Buyers can opt to purchase the device with RAM and SSD included, although current prices are announced for the do-it-yourself versions: with a 12-core Core i5-12600H processor for $250, and a 14-core Core i7-12800H processor for $310.
This compact computer is equipped with a USB4 port, Wi-Fi 6E and Bluetooth 5.2 adapters, as well as two 2.5Gbps ports. The USB4 technology promises remarkably fast data transfer rates, making it ideal for users requiring quick access to large files.
Weighing just 600 grams, the mini PC can be mounted on a wall or onto the back of a monitor. For this purpose, it includes HDMI 2.1 and DP 1.4 ports, complemented by a couple of USB-A 2.0 and USB-A 3.2 Gen2 ports.
